WordPress图片优化与管理全攻略,提升网站速度与用户体验

来自:素雅营销研究院

头像 方知笔记
2025年05月29日 22:16

WordPress作为全球最受欢迎的内容管理系统,图片处理是其核心功能之一。合理优化和管理图片不仅能显著提升网站加载速度,还能改善用户体验并有利于SEO排名。本文将全面介绍WordPress中的图片处理技巧。

一、WordPress图片上传基础操作

在WordPress中上传图片非常简单,只需在文章或页面编辑界面点击”添加媒体”按钮,然后选择本机图片文件即可。WordPress会自动生成多种尺寸的缩略图,包括:

  • 缩略图(150x150像素)
  • 中等大小(300x300像素)
  • 大尺寸(1024x1024像素)
  • 完整尺寸(原始大小)

这些预设尺寸可以在”设置”→”媒体”中进行调整,以适应不同主题的需求。

二、WordPress图片优化技巧

  1. 压缩图片大小:上传前使用工具如TinyPNG或ShortPixel压缩图片,可减少60-80%的文件大小而不明显损失质量。

  2. 选择合适的格式

  • JPEG:适合照片类图像
  • PNG:适合需要透明背景的图形
  • WebP:新一代格式,比JPEG小30%左右
  1. 使用懒加载技术:安装插件如a3 Lazy Load,只有当图片进入视口时才加载,显著提升首屏速度。

  2. CDN加速:通过Cloudflare或Jetpack等服务的CDN分发图片,减少服务器负载并加快全球访问速度。

三、推荐WordPress图片插件

  1. Smush:自动压缩上传的图片,支持批量优化已有图片
  2. NextGEN Gallery:创建精美的图片画廊和幻灯片
  3. Envira Gallery:响应式图片画廊插件,支持灯箱效果
  4. WP Retina 2x:自动为高分辨率设备提供2倍清晰图片

四、WordPress图片SEO最佳实践

  1. 为每张图片添加描述性的文件名(避免使用”IMG_1234.jpg”)
  2. 填写ALT文本(替代文本),这对SEO和无障碍访问都至关重要
  3. 添加标题和说明文字,增强图片的上下文相关性
  4. 使用结构化数据标记图片,帮助搜索引擎理解图片内容

五、高级技巧:WordPress图片处理API

对于开发者,WordPress提供了强大的图片处理API:

// 获取图片的不同尺寸
$image_src = wp_get_attachment_image_src( $attachment_id, 'full' );

// 在主题中输出响应式图片
echo wp_get_attachment_image( $attachment_id, 'large', false, array( 'class' => 'img-responsive' ) );

通过合理利用这些API,可以创建完全自定义的图片展示效果。

结语

WordPress的图片管理看似简单,但深入优化后能带来显著的性能提升和用户体验改善。从基础的上传操作到高级的CDN加速、懒加载技术,再到专业的SEO优化,每一环节都值得投入精力。选择适合的插件并遵循最佳实践,你的WordPress网站图片将既美观又高效。